So I bought a traktor 2 key from a fellow forum member. He said it came with is Z2 and that he didn’t need it. I installed traktor 2 and tried to activate it and was told that I didnt have the appropriate base product to upgrade. Is this activation code tied to the Z2?
Pretty positive on this. They say they are non-transferable. In fact if you got a Z2 with Traktor 2 and later wanted to sell your Z2 NI will (try to) make you transfer the license as well. The X1 keys weren’t tied to hardware. NI started tying traktor keys to hardware when they started selling the f1. You should try and get your money back from him because you aren’t going to be able to use it unless you have the z2 hardware key as well.
I had the EXACT same thing happen to me. Some guy bought a Z2 but he didnt need the traktor license so he sold the key to me. Just like yours it didnt work so I called NI and they said that the only way I could use the software is if I used it with the Z2. They are paired software with hardware. It is CLEARLY stated in the EULA that the seller agreed to that he bought a Hardware/Software Bundle and that it is not permitted to sell one without the other.
The “Base Product” is any product bought with or prior to the a product that is installed alongside or after the original product. In this case the Z2 is the “Base Product” as the seller bought the Z2 and that came with a a complimentary copy of Traktor (this is why people need to get the idea that the software IS FREE into their heads).
You should seek a refund from the seller. He is in breach of the EULA and if reported could have his account suspended thus rendering all his NI products unregistered/deactivated and without support.
